About Sir Roger Tempest, III, of Bracewell
Roger Tempest ll, son of Richard Tempest (c. 1148-aft. 1178) and Alice le Meschin, was born abt. 1174 in Bracewell, Yorkshire, England. He married Alice de Rillieston, daughter of Elias de Rillieston and Alice Hebden in abt. 1199. He paid a fine of half a mark for unjust disseisen, 14th of Henry II, 1167/8. He died in 1209.
